Egypt’s Bassant Hemida wins gold at international athletics meet in Italy
The Egyptian National Council for Women, led by Justice Amal Ammar, has extended heartfelt congratulations to Egyptian sprint athlete Basant Hemida for her outstanding achievement in securing the gold medal in the 400-meter race at the prestigious Lucca International Meeting in Italy.
In a statement issued on Monday, Justice Amal Ammar expressed great pride and joy over Hemida’s sporting success, describing it as a significant milestone and an inspiring addition to the growing list of international achievements by Egyptian women in sports. She emphasized that such victories highlight the remarkable skill and talent of Egyptian women, particularly in track and field events.
Hemida’s accomplishment is celebrated not only as a personal triumph but also as a testament to the progress and excellence of Egyptian women on the world stage.
